Skip to content

Commit 92e3244

Browse files
committed
Merge branch 'main' into v15/feature/emm-health-check
2 parents 995fe84 + 129e9ef commit 92e3244

File tree

7 files changed

+18
-14
lines changed

7 files changed

+18
-14
lines changed

src/packages/core/dashboard/dashboard.extension.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
import type { UmbDashboardElement } from '../extension-registry/interfaces/index.js';
1+
import type { UmbDashboardElement } from './dashboard-element.interface.js';
22
import type { ManifestElement, ManifestWithDynamicConditions } from '@umbraco-cms/backoffice/extension-api';
33

44
export interface ManifestDashboard
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,15 @@
1-
export type * from './global-context.extension.js';
2-
export type * from './header-app.extension.js';
3-
export type * from './repository.extension.js';
41
export type * from './app-entry-point.extension.js';
5-
export type * from './entity-action.extension.js';
62
export type * from './backoffice-entry-point.extension.js';
3+
export type * from './entity-action.extension.js';
74
export type * from './entity-bulk-action.extension.js';
85
export type * from './entity-user-permission.extension.js';
96
export type * from './entry-point.extension.js';
7+
export type * from './global-context.extension.js';
8+
export type * from './header-app.extension.js';
9+
export type * from './menu-item-element.interface.js';
1010
export type * from './menu-item.extension.js';
1111
export type * from './menu-item-element.interface.js';
1212
export type * from './menu.extension.js';
1313
export type * from './preview-app.extension.js';
14+
export type * from './repository.extension.js';
1415
export type * from './store.extension.js';

src/packages/core/extension-registry/models/index.ts

Lines changed: 2 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,6 @@ import type { ManifestUserProfileApp } from './user-profile-app.model.js';
1010
import type { ManifestGranularUserPermission } from './user-granular-permission.model.js';
1111
import type { ManifestMfaLoginProvider } from './mfa-login-provider.model.js';
1212
import type { ManifestMonacoMarkdownEditorAction } from './monaco-markdown-editor-action.model.js';
13-
import type { ManifestPickerSearchResultItem } from './picker-search-result-item.model.js';
1413
import type { ManifestBase, ManifestBundle, ManifestCondition } from '@umbraco-cms/backoffice/extension-api';
1514

1615
export type * from './auth-provider.model.js';
@@ -20,10 +19,10 @@ export type * from './file-upload-preview.model.js';
2019
export type * from './external-login-provider.model.js';
2120
export type * from './mfa-login-provider.model.js';
2221
export type * from './monaco-markdown-editor-action.model.js';
23-
export type * from './picker-search-result-item.model.js';
2422
export type * from './mfa-login-provider.model.js';
2523
export type * from './monaco-markdown-editor-action.model.js';
26-
export type * from './picker-search-result-item.model.js';
24+
export type * from './mfa-login-provider.model.js';
25+
export type * from './monaco-markdown-editor-action.model.js';
2726
export type * from './tinymce-plugin.model.js';
2827
export type * from './ufm-component.model.js';
2928
export type * from './ufm-filter.model.js';
@@ -43,10 +42,6 @@ export type ManifestTypes =
4342
| ManifestGranularUserPermission
4443
| ManifestMfaLoginProvider
4544
| ManifestMonacoMarkdownEditorAction
46-
| ManifestPickerSearchResultItem
47-
| ManifestMfaLoginProvider
48-
| ManifestMonacoMarkdownEditorAction
49-
| ManifestPickerSearchResultItem
5045
| ManifestTinyMcePlugin
5146
| ManifestUfmComponent
5247
| ManifestUfmFilter
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,4 @@
11
export * from './manager/index.js';
2-
export * from './picker-search-result.element.js';
32
export * from './picker-search-field.element.js';
3+
export * from './picker-search-result.element.js';
4+
export * from './result-item/index.js';

src/packages/core/picker/search/picker-search-result.element.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,10 +1,10 @@
11
import { UMB_PICKER_CONTEXT } from '../picker.context.token.js';
22
import type { UmbPickerContext } from '../picker.context.js';
3+
import type { ManifestPickerSearchResultItem } from './result-item/picker-search-result-item.extension.js';
34
import { customElement, html, nothing, repeat, state } from '@umbraco-cms/backoffice/external/lit';
45
import { UmbLitElement } from '@umbraco-cms/backoffice/lit-element';
56
import type { UmbSearchRequestArgs } from '@umbraco-cms/backoffice/search';
67
import type { UmbEntityModel } from '@umbraco-cms/backoffice/entity';
7-
import type { ManifestPickerSearchResultItem } from '@umbraco-cms/backoffice/extension-registry';
88

99
const elementName = 'umb-picker-search-result';
1010
@customElement(elementName)
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1 @@
1+
export * from './picker-search-result-item.extension.js';

src/packages/core/extension-registry/models/picker-search-result-item.model.ts renamed to src/packages/core/picker/search/result-item/picker-search-result-item.extension.ts

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,3 +7,9 @@ export interface ManifestPickerSearchResultItem extends ManifestElementAndApi {
77
type: 'pickerSearchResultItem';
88
forEntityTypes: Array<string>;
99
}
10+
11+
declare global {
12+
interface UmbExtensionManifestMap {
13+
umbPickerSearchResultItem: ManifestPickerSearchResultItem;
14+
}
15+
}

0 commit comments

Comments
 (0)